§ 3261.15   Must I give BLM my drilling permit application, drilling program and operations plan at the same time?

No, you may submit your complete and signed drilling permit application and complete drilling program and operations plan either together or separately.

(a) If you submit them together and we approve your drilling permit, the approved drilling permit will authorize both the pad construction and the drilling and testing of the well.

(b) If you submit the operations plan separately from the drilling permit and program, you must:

(1) Submit the operations plan before the drilling permit application and drilling program to allow BLM time to comply with NEPA; and

(2) Submit a complete and signed sundry notice for well pad and access road construction. Do not begin construction until we approve your sundry notice.
